Output 4c366ca006ca66930146f8b2ca39a6e6148f9f595ebfd763f2ea3091652c38e3:20

value
2586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38d21a35a954637239cd690b83b84287e32cc4f750e4962a5c47ec9e275f0576
address
bc1p8rfp5ddf233hywwddy9c8wzzsl3je38h2rjfv2juglkfuf6lq4mqs4sv7v
transaction
4c366ca006ca66930146f8b2ca39a6e6148f9f595ebfd763f2ea3091652c38e3
confirmations
138630
spent
true